Re:Burn Deck

My "Flash Fire" burn deck is extremely effective against any and all current meta decks. Its only disadvantages are:

Susceptible to being OTK'd by something like Demise, King of Armageddon or Judgment Dragon.
Susceptible to trap negation (Royal Decree, Jinzo).
Needs more draw power (2x Allure of Darkness will fix that - 3x Shadowpriestess of Ohm along with 3x Giant Germ and maybe 1-2x Cannon Soldier will give the deck extreme draw power).

Other than those, this is a solid deck with no notable weaknesses. Since no-one main or side decks Lifeforce Harmonizers or other counter-burn cards, it is mildly uncontested. Its real issue is speed: it tries to be faster than the opposing deck, but that does not always happen, or is downright impossible (against Tele-DAD i.e., or Demise Salvo OTK).

All in all, it's up to how the player makes use of the precious few cards they draw. In average, you can win a duel by your 3rd Draw Phase, considering you have an average hand. With a great one you can win by the 2nd turn. NO OTKs (at least none until I get my Allures).
